Output f4037fc80ad943b17acb544728765cb76ce3909bd7b71166e4300fca344faeef:0

value
2640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2173b1ec3aeddb34ea30340c2e05e56c2fa872f7 OP_EQUAL
address
34jtpWDBR9qiMKi7hDtU29KeqawecQ8bAp
transaction
f4037fc80ad943b17acb544728765cb76ce3909bd7b71166e4300fca344faeef
confirmations
463722
spent
true